Northern Territory Consolidated Acts48A. Abrogation of rule in Weldon v Neal
(1) If a court would, but for the expiry of a relevant period of limitation after the day a proceeding in the court has commenced, allow a party to amend a document in the proceeding, the court shall allow the amendment to be made if it is satisfied that no other party to the proceeding would by reason of the amendment be prejudiced in the conduct of that party's claim or defence in a way that could not be met by an adjournment, an award of costs or otherwise.
(2) This section does not apply to an amendment in a proceeding commenced before the commencement of this section.
